Default apex-i n1 single exhaust (pics and vid)

i had 2.5 inch aluminized piping done for 200 bucks. the pipes are not mandrel bent, but the piping required little bending so i dont think its a big deal using crush bending. the muffler is a 3" inlet, 4.5" tip apex-i n1 turbo which i picked up for 125 shipped with silencer.

i absolutely love the sound of this thing.... it is very deep, and also pretty loud. however, my sense of what is "loud" is limited because ive never heard an sc3 with aftermarket exhaust before.
